Optical Precision Inspection – Visibility & Appearance Consistency

Purpose : To verify that optical characteristics and surface conditions adhere to design tolerances, and to ensure that environmental substance concentrations comply with regulatory standards.
Typical Test Items/Equipment: * Total Luminous Transmittance Meter, Spectrophotometer , IR Transmittance Tester.

Dimensional & Structural Measurement – Tolerance, Alignment, and Assembly Matching

Purpose : To ensure that circuitry, profiles, and 3D structures adhere to design tolerances, minimizing assembly interference and defects.
Typical Test Items/Equipment: Automated Size Measurer, 3D Microscopic Observation , Film Thickness Measurement.

Durability & Reliability – Abrasion, Peeling, Drop, and Cycle Life

Purpose: Simulate long-term high-frequency operation and transportation impacts to reduce post-production failure rates and warranty risks. Representative test items/equipment: peeling force, wear resistance, pencil hardness, button/slide cycle, drop ball impact tester, packaging drop, etc.

Material Properties & Process Fundamentals Measurement – Material Consistency & Process Stability

Purpose: Verify physical properties and consistency of materials such as glass, film, adhesives, and inks to prevent yield loss caused by material variation.
Typical Test Items/Equipment: Ink Viscosity Tester, Conductivity/Resistance Meter, Pressure-Related Measurement Devices, etc.

Process Environment Monitoring – Cleanroom & Environmental Parameters

Purpose: Monitor airborne particles, illumination, temperature, humidity, etc., to ensure R2R and sheet-fed processes operate in a stable environment and minimize external interference.
Typical Test Items/Equipment: Airborne Particle Counter, Illuminance Meter, etc.

Electrostatic & Electrical Protection – Safeguarding Core Circuits and Sensors

Purpose: Validate electrostatic immunity and protection design to reduce latent damage and early failure caused by electrostatic discharge.
Typical Test Items/Equipment: Electrostatic Discharge (ESD) Test, Electrostatic Voltage Measurement, Electrostatic Resistance Measurement, etc.

Environmental Stress Validation – Temperature/Humidity, Thermal Shock, etc.

Purpose: Simulate extreme environments that automotive and outdoor equipment may encounter, proactively identify failure modes, and enhance reliability.
Typical Test Items/Equipment: Constant Temperature & Humidity Chamber, Thermal Shock Chamber, High-Temperature Chamber, High-Temperature & High-Humidity Chamber, Low-Temperature Chamber, etc.

Sensor Function Inspection – Pre-Shipment Functional Validation

Purpose: Perform electrical and signal verification on sensor layers and connection interfaces to reduce post-shipment defects and returns.
Typical Inspection Items: Surface Conductivity and Impedance Measurement, Electrical Isolation Verification, Connector Function Check, Signal Function Validation, etc.
